Business and Law Faculty Advisory Board

Board members have expertise in law, finance, corporate leadership, executive education, governance, international business, and curriculum innovation. They provide valuable insight into the skills, knowledge, and attributes needed to succeed in today’s global workplace.

Carol Osbourne

Partner and Global Department Leader (Corporate and Finance), BCLP

Carol is a highly experienced corporate lawyer. She has more than 30 years of experience advising clients on complex legal and commercial matters that support business growth and international expansion.

Her expertise includes high-value commercial agreements, joint ventures, strategic alliances, and cross-border mergers and acquisitions. She is qualified in the UK and the United States. This gives her a strong international perspective and extensive experience of supporting organisations across several jurisdictions.

Carol is a senior leader at BCLP. She specialises in corporate and finance transactions and oversees a global team of lawyers. Her previous senior leadership roles include Global Leader of the Technology, Commercial and Government Affairs practice group. She has also served as Co-Head of M&A and Corporate Finance for EMEA.

Her sector expertise covers retail and consumer industries. She advises manufacturers, retailers, and private equity investors. Her experience includes luxury retail, food and beverage, beauty and personal care, and apparel and accessories.

Jeremy Chapman

Founder, Integrity Centre and Honestley Ltd

Jeremy is an award-winning wealth manager, author, and co-founder of The Integrity Centre. He has almost four decades of experience in financial services.

His work presents integrity as a practical discipline that extends beyond compliance and conformity. It focuses on how values shape decisions in business, society, and personal conduct.

Jeremy completed his Doctor of Professional Studies by Public Works at 探花社区 University in March 2024. His research examined his work in financial services, social enterprise, and values education. It explored what integrity means in practice and how people apply it.

This research led to the Integrity Wealth Model. The model challenges the pursuit of "more" and promotes alignment, purpose, and responsibility.

Jeremy has since lectured at universities and written about professional ethics and identity. He is the author of True North: The Compass Inside. The book supports young people as they navigate values and peer pressure. He is developing further work.

Sharmla Chetty

Chief Executive Officer, Duke Corporate Education

Sharmla is a globally recognised leader in the future of work and business transformation. She has more than two decades of experience advising CEOs, boards, and policymakers in over 80 countries.

Her work focuses on aligning human capability with innovation, economic growth, and social impact. She helps organisations develop future-ready talent, close skills gaps, and build inclusive and accountable cultures.

Sharmla is the 2025 AWCA Woman of Substance. The award recognises her influence in business and her commitment to expanding opportunities for women across Africa and globally.

She founded Duke CE’s South Africa office in 2007. Under her leadership, it became the continent’s leading provider of custom executive education. She later became CEO of Duke Corporate Education.

Sharmla has expertise in leadership development, talent strategy, and culture change. Her sector experience includes financial services, healthcare, energy, mining, and manufacturing. She has also led initiatives that promote skills development and gender equity in leadership.

Sindi Mabaso-Koyana

Chairperson, AWCA Investment Holdings and Managing Partner, AIH Capital

Sindi is a South African business leader, chartered accountant, and advocate for women’s leadership in finance and governance. She founded the African Women Chartered Accountants (AWCA) organisation. This initiative has transformed the accounting profession in South Africa.

Her career spans auditing, financial management, and corporate governance. She has held senior leadership roles in the private and public sectors. She has also served on the boards of some of South Africa’s most influential institutions.

Throughout her career, Sindi has promoted ethical governance, social equity, and the advancement of women in business.

Through AWCA, she has mentored many young professionals. She has also built a network that supports aspiring accountants and future business leaders.

Sindi led the formation of AWCA Investment Holdings and its private equity arm, AIH Capital, where she is Managing Partner. 探花社区 University has awarded her an Honorary Doctorate. The South African Institute of Chartered Accountants has also named her a Visionary Finance Leader.

Dr K.K. Ramachandran

Vice Principal, Dr. GRD College of Science and Director and Professor, GRD Institute of Management, School of Commerce & International Business

K.K. Ramachandran is an educator and academic leader who specialises in commerce, management, and international business. His work focuses on curriculum innovation, employability, and experiential learning.

He holds a double PhD in Marketing and Management. He is a Fulbright Fellow, a Fellow of the Chartered Management Institute (UK), and a Fellow of the Royal Society of Arts (UK).

K.K. Ramachandran has held international academic roles, including a position at the University of Southampton. He also contributes to academic governance through advisory, examination, and curriculum leadership roles across institutions and boards.

His work covers teaching, research, and academic leadership. It supports applied and practice-oriented learning in business education.

His academic output includes more than 100 research publications, several books and book chapters, and several patents. He has also supervised many scholars in commerce and management.

His work in pedagogy includes advanced training with institutions such as Harvard Business Publishing. It focuses on innovative and applied learning in higher education.
